Abstract

According to the practical reservoir characteristics of the study area, the feasibility of horizontal wells development was analyzed, and the result showed that the reservoir characteristics of study area were suit to develop horizontal wells. Based on the establishment of three-dimensional fine geological modeling of study area, using numerical simulation, the well network pattern, length of the horizontal section, well spacing, row spacing and development indicators were predicted. The simulation result showed that the optimal well network was the symmetrical horizontal section, and the horizontal well had echelonment horizontal sections traversing the two layers of Mawu12 and Mawu13, and the well spacing and row spacing were both 2 100 m. The result of development indicators prediction showed that, after 10 years, the recovery percentage was 48.78 %, which was 16.6 % higher than that of vertical wells. The study result can guide the study area to develop efficiently.
